Precautions
- Operate the unit only on 4.5 V DC
For AC operation, use the recommended Sony AC power adaptor. Do not use any other type of AC power adaptors for this unit. - Do not open the unit. Refer servicing to qualified personnel only.
- Do not place the unit in a hot or humid place, or in a place subject to excessive dust or vibration.
- Avoid rough handling.
- Clean the unit with a soft cloth slightly dampened with a mild detergent solution. Never use strong solvents, such as thinner or benzine, as they may damage the finish.
Power Sources (see fig. A)
Alkaline Batteries
See fig. A-①.
Battery Life: With continuous use, Sony LR6/AM3(N) alkaline batteries will last about 2.5 hours.
Note
When the picture becomes dim or the tuning does not lock onto a channel, replace all the batteries with new ones.
House Current
See fig. A—b.
Note
Use only the recommended AC power adaptor. (For the polarity of the plug, see fig. A-©).
Operation (see fig. B)
Watching the TV
1 Set the RADIO/TV/OFF switch to TV.
2 Set the VHF/UHF switch to VHF or UHF, whichever band you want to watch.
3 Press the CH +/- button to select a channel.
4 Adjust the volume with the VOL dial.
5 Adjust the brightness with the BRT dial.
Listening to the radio
1 Set the RADIO/TV/OFF switch to RADIO.
2 Set the AM/FM switch to AM or FM, whichever band you want to receive.
3 Tune in to a station with the RADIO TUNING dial.
4 Adjust the volume with the VOL dial.
To switch off the TV and radio: Set the RADIO/TV/OFF switch to OFF.
To improve the broadcast reception
TV, FM: Fully extend the right side of the strap antenna while pushing the RELEASE button and move the unit in every direction. (See fig. B-①). AM: Move the unit in every direction. (See fig. B-⑥).
To adjust the strap length: Hold the RELEASE button down and adjust the right side of the strap antenna.
Note
For safety reasons, the left side of the strap antenna is designed to disconnect when pulled too strongly. If this happens, please contact your nearest Sony dealer.
Listening with headphones: Connect headphones (not supplied) to the (headphones) jack.

Troubleshooting
The unit does not operate.
• The AC power adaptor is disconnected.
• Incorrect battery polarity.
- Weak batteries.
Herringbone pattern, double images, stripes, too indistinct, etc.
- Improper tuning or antenna setting.
Dotted lines or stripes
- Often caused by interference from other electric appliances.
- Adjust the strap antenna.
No sound from the speaker
• Volume is turned down completely.
• Headphones are connected.
No sound and picture from the TV but sound from the radio is normal.
- Weak batteries.
If you have any questions or problems concerning your unit, please consult your nearest Sony service facility.
Specifications
TV
TV standard
American TV standard
Channel coverage
VHF: 2 - 13
UHF: 14 - 69
Display format
Transmission type TN liquid crystal panel
Drive format Passive matrix
Picture 2.2 inches measured diagonally
Radio
Frequency AM: 530–1605 kHz
FM: 87.5–108 MHz
Antenna VHF/UHF/FM: Strap antenna
AM: Ferrite bar antenna
(mounted within the unit)
Output Headphones: minijack (mono) Impedance 8 - 45 ohms
Power requirements
4.5 V DC
Power consumption
Approx. 3.3 W
Speaker ∅28 mm (1 1/8 in.), 0.1 W
Dimensions Approx. 82.0 × 149.8 × 49.8 mm
(3 ^1 /4×6×2 in.)(w/h/d)
excl. projecting parts and controls
Strap length Approx.1,420 mm (56 in.)
Mass Approx. 280 g (9.9 oz), excl.
batteries
Design and specifications are subject to change without notice.
Optional accessories
AC power adaptor AC-E45HG/Size AA (LR6)
alkaline battery
